Passports & Visas

Travelers must obtain their own Passports to travel.  You must have a PASSPORT BOOK, not a Passport Card, to travel to our countries. 

If you already have a passport, the expiration date MUST be at least 6 months after the date you arrive back in the US following our trip. TRIPLE CHECK YOUR EXPIRATION DATE - EVEN ONE DAY SHORT CAN PREVENT YOU FROM LEAVING THE U.S. OR THE COUNTRY YOU TRAVEL TO - DON'T RISK IT!

- If your passport is worn or torn or you do not have at least 10 pages left in it, replace it! Many countries will not accept a worn or damaged (even by water) passport and you must have enough pages left in it for several stamps in each country.

- If you don't have a passport or need to renew it, you can do so on your own. See State department application link below OR make an appointment with USPS (link below). 

There are no guarantees on processing time so do it NOW & expedite it for better tracking.

- AAA only takes passport photos now - they do not process applications.

- You will need acceptable headshot photos (get them at CVS, Walgreens, or AAA) and two forms of ID to send in with your application & fees.

Our travel partners will provide any necessary Visas at entry to countries. You do not need to obtain your own.
